Description

4-Amino-3-hydroxynaphthalene-1-sulfonic acid is utilized as a fluorescent dye. 4-Amino-3-hydroxynaphthalene-1-sulfonic acid forms polypyrrole (PPy) conducting film with pyrrole, and is utilized in electrochemie[1][2].
